For Depression "150 mg XL-brand WB, 2 wks, then 300 mg. Day 3 on 150 mg, INCREDIBLY restless, irritable, angry, which lasted 5 days, then felt normal until I upped the dose. 2 days, 300 mg SO angry, irritable, restless more than before. Emotionally exhausting. Feel more depressed than ever. Lasted nonstop 3.5 weeks. I was a nightmare. I isolated myself, luckily, I work freelance, so able to not work. Did have more energy, channeled into exercise, healthy diet, cleaning. It helped to focus on things, read many Wellbutrin reviews online. Helped to not feel crazy. Week #6 started to feel better. Not 'happy' but no longer crazy emotions. Week 7 now. I have more energy than before starting, more goal-oriented & drive to get things done. Again, don't feel 'happy' but don't feel like depression is in the driver's seat, so can do what needs doing, including changing external factors that add to depression. Still quick to irritation. Stopped smoking week 5. Glad where I am now, but adjustment period much more difficult than could have imagined."

For Depression "I am a 52-year-old man, and I have been experiencing constant headaches/migraines and degenerative neck/spinal issues with an unknown cause. To manage my symptoms, I have been taking various medications that have different side effects, leading me to feel depressed. Additionally, I have been smoking for over 35 years. In an effort to address both my depression and potentially quit smoking, I asked my primary care physician to prescribe Wellbutrin XL. Although I had no intention of quitting smoking, I began taking 150 mg once a day. Surprisingly, after only two weeks, I woke up one morning and decided to quit smoking. I did not experience intense cravings or mood swings during the transition. It has been a month since I quit smoking, and although my depression has not completely subsided, I am feeling alright. The only obstacle I have encountered is that many things taste bitter, even water. Nonetheless, my smoking habit is going away nicely. I recommend giving Wellbutrin XL a try if you are considering quitting smoking, even if you do not have the intention to do so. It worked for me."

For Seasonal Affective Disorder "For the first 5-7 years, this Wellbutrin worked 100% for SAD; the only side effect was memory problems, but it didn't matter because I was doing so well. I was taking 300 mg/day year-round. After 6 years or so, it started to not work as well. 450 mg helped for one winter, but the next winter it only helped for around 2 weeks. I tried going off it one summer (in case I had built up a tolerance) and felt 'blah' all the time, and going back on it, it only took that away initially. For the last 2 years or so, I felt that blah-ness while on 300 mg/day; a constant low-moderate grade depression/apathy/numbness, and mental emptiness too. It completely stopped working for SAD. I hope others who benefit like I did initially don't experience this too."
